What are entry level retrieval augmented generation jobs?

Entry level retrieval augmented generation jobs involve assisting in the development and optimization of AI systems that combine information retrieval techniques with generative models. Employees in these roles typically help build, test, and maintain systems where AI retrieves relevant data from large databases to enhance the accuracy and relevance of generated responses. These positions often require basic skills in programming, machine learning, and familiarity with natural language processing. They are ideal for recent graduates or those new to AI, offering opportunities to learn about modern AI architectures and contribute to innovative projects. Entry level workers may work under the guidance of senior engineers or researchers, supporting experimentation and evaluation tasks.

What are some common challenges faced by entry-level professionals working in Retrieval Augmented Generation (RAG) roles?

Entry-level professionals in Retrieval Augmented Generation (RAG) often encounter challenges such as understanding how to effectively combine information retrieval systems with large language models and adapting to rapidly evolving technologies. Balancing accuracy and efficiency when designing or fine-tuning retrieval pipelines can also be a learning curve. Additionally, you may need to collaborate closely with data engineers, machine learning specialists, and product teams to ensure the RAG system aligns with business requirements. Staying proactive in learning and engaging with peers can help overcome these challenges and accelerate career growth.
